40% of GLP-1-induced weight loss is lean body mass (muscle + bone) without resistance training + protein optimization. Most patients need 1.2-1.6 g/kg body weight daily.
Sarcopenia (muscle loss) is the silent cost of rapid weight loss. Most patients hit goal weight with significantly less lean mass than they started — which reduces metabolic rate, increases regain risk, and creates the "skinny fat" body composition. Protein supplementation + resistance training prevents this.
GLP-1s suppress appetite globally — protein intake drops proportional to total caloric reduction. But the body still needs the same absolute protein for muscle protein synthesis (MPS). Without supplementation, MPS falls below muscle protein breakdown (MPB) → net catabolism. Resistance training amplifies MPS sensitivity to dietary protein.

1.2-1.6 g/kg body weight daily during active weight loss. For a 200 lb person (91 kg): 109-145g protein/day. Most GLP-1 patients eating 1,200-1,500 calories struggle to hit this without supplementation.
Whey has higher bio-availability (~95% vs ~85% for plant). For most patients, whey is more efficient. For dairy-intolerant patients (some develop this from GLP-1 gut sensitivity), pea or hemp blends are equivalent in practice.
Recommended if you can afford. Standard scales hide lean mass loss. DEXA costs $100-200 per scan at body comp clinics. Baseline + 6 months catches sarcopenia before it's irreversible.
